ouch in English
- ouch⇄noun 1. a brooch or buckle worn as an ornament.
2. the setting of a precious stone, usually part of a brooch or buckle.
Ex. onyx stones inclosed in ouches of gold (Exodus 39:6).
3. a glittering jewel; precious ornament; gem. - ouch⇄ouch (1), interjection.
an exclamation expressing sudden pain. - ouch⇄ouch (2), noun, verb.
(Obsolete.) - ouch⇄v.t. to adorn with or as if with gems.
Ex. A lamplit bridge ouching the troubled sky (W. E. Henley).
